1.
a small lively dog belonging to any of the breeds originally developed to hunt animals living in underground burrows, but now common as pets.
2.
a member of the British Army's Territorial and Volunteer Reserve
3.
in English legal history, a land register or survey
4.
a small dog that people keep as a pet and is sometimes used for hunting small animals
5.
a person who is very determined and will not give up trying until they get something that they want, such as information
